About Standard Lithium Ltd

Standard Lithium Ltd. is a company focused on the development of lithium projects in North America, with a primary focus on extracting lithium from brine resources. Their flagship projects aim to utilize proprietary, advanced direct lithium extraction (DLE) technologies to produce high-purity lithium compounds in an environmentally responsible manner. The company seeks to become a key domestic supplier to the growing electric vehicle and battery storage markets.

About Synchrony Financial

Synchrony Financial is a premier consumer financial services company and the largest provider of private-label credit cards in the United States. Spun off from GE Capital in 2014, it operates through a unique B2B2C model, embedding its financing products within the ecosystems of major partners like Amazon, Lowe’s, and PayPal. Synchrony leverages deep data analytics and a diverse multi-platform strategy—spanning retail, health, and auto—to drive customer loyalty and provide specialized credit solutions at the point of sale.
